An accessible and informative overview of the political and cultural history of Europe in the High Middle Ages, focusing on the interplay between papal and secular power, the rise of Italian city-states, and the impact of the Crusades on the Holy Land. The author offers a colorful and engaging narrative of the major personalities and events of the period, and shows how they shaped the emergence of modern Europe.
